I'd appreciate any input you might have, Randy. I've already contacted
the So.SF. Planning Dept. wrt the graded lot at the corner of Haskins and
Jamie Court in So. SF downwind of the current Tigers launch, and have
been told that there is no plan for that site currently on file yet.
This is the ideal launch for Tigers cause it is far enough out to not be
effected by the tide height, yet it does not have a wind shadow. This
site is next to the beach at which many sailors trim equipment, south of
the pier with the yellow crane. I was told that the lot is owned by the
Haskins Corp. which is currently using the site for storage of land fill
materials. I was also told that once the Planning Dept. has the plans
for improvement of the site, that they will forward them to BCDC for
their approval, and because the lot is adjacent to the bayfront, that a
bayfront trail and public access will be required.

I'm going to follow up with my contact at the SoSF Planning Dept. on a
bi-monthly basis, so if you have any other suggestions, please let me
know. I'd especially be interested in access issues vis-a-vis beach
grading and improvement, sufficient parking, rigging areas, launches,
perhaps a restroom or porta-john, and 24 hour access to such.

Also, I'd be interested, if you know, what the current law is on
easements across existing private property to navigable waterways. If
I'm not mistaken, they're required. Note that Jamie Court currently is
posted "No Parking" along it's entire length.
